RIP: Beloved grandmother of Tipp camogie captain passes away just hours after Munster triumph

RIP: Beloved grandmother of Tipp camogie captain passes away just hours after Munster triumph

There was a massive array of contrasting emotions for Tipperary camogie captain Karen Kennedy last Saturday after leading her side to a Munster title in FBD Semple Stadium, when news filtered through that her beloved grandmother Anne 'Nance' Kennedy had passed away suddenly on Saturday evening.

She passed away in her 96th year peacefully at her home surrounded by her loving family. Predeceased by her husband Martin and son Declan (Deck), will be sadly missed by her adored family, daughter Nora (Moore), sons Tom, P.J., John and Fintan, son-in-law Denis, daughters-in-law Margaret, Eileen, Nora and Margaret, her 16 cherished grandchildren and three great grandchildren, sister-in-law Maureen and cousin Eugene, her wonderful carers, nieces, nephews, relatives and friends.

She will be reposing in Kennedy's Funeral Home, Dublin Road, Thurles this Monday evening from 5 p.m. to 7 p.m. to arrive in the Cathedral of the Assumption on Tuesday morning at 10.30 a.m. for Funeral Mass at 11 a.m. followed by burial in St. Patrick's Cemetery.
